A Crucial Lifeline at Gelora Bumi Kartini Stadium
Average Entertainment Futmetrix Score: 54/100. A ruthless display from the hosts plunged their opponents deeper into the relegation abyss while successfully securing a vital buffer in the bottom-half scrap.
Early Control and the First Blow
The Stakes were palpable from the first touch at Gelora Bumi Kartini Stadium, with both sides desperate for top-flight survival in this gritty relegation battle. Persijap quickly settled into a dominant rhythm, suffocating the visitors and forcing them into disjointed sequences across the middle of the park. They controlled possession with 55 percent of the ball, dictating the early tempo and restricting their desperate opponents to mere scraps. The vital breakthrough arrived in the 20th minute when B. Herrera capitalised on a highly surgical pass from B. Martinez, punishing a notably fragile defensive line that failed to track back in time. This early advantage set an aggressive tone for the remainder of the half, establishing an uncompromising battle where every single tackle carried the immense weight of a bottom-half six-pointer.
The Spot-Kick Disaster
Every crucial football fixture hinges on a singular, defining moment, and this clash was absolutely no exception to the rule. Trailing by a single goal and desperate for a lifeline, PSBS Biak Numfor were handed a golden opportunity to alter the trajectory of their dismal season when they won a crucial penalty in the 28th minute. Luquinhas confidently stepped up, bearing the heavy, unspoken burden of his team's disastrous five-match losing streak. However, his devastating miss from the spot kept the visitors scoreless and entirely deflated their bench. This failure to convert immediately drained their attacking Intensity and allowed the home side to rapidly reassert their authority on the contest. The missed penalty proved ultimately fatal, functioning as a devastating psychological blow for a beleaguered squad already heavily anchored to the foot of the league table.
Sealing the Relegation Fate
With the visitors' fragile morale completely shattered by that first-half failure, the hosts decisively twisted the knife during a highly physical second half. Relentless set-piece pressure—perfectly highlighted by a staggering 12 corners for the home side out of 15 total in the match—kept the defending backline pinned incredibly deep inside their own defensive third. The final, insurmountable nail in the coffin was delivered by Franca Carlos in the 67th minute, instinctively and clinically finishing a smart feed from I. Guarrotxena to comfortably double the advantage. The severe lack of structural Balance on the pitch was glaringly evident as the match drifted seamlessly towards its inevitable conclusion. This routine but essential victory brilliantly extends the home side's impressive unbeaten run while pushing the visiting squad one fatal step closer to the inevitable drop.

Survival on the Line: Persijap Host PSBS Biak Numfor in Desperate Duel
Worth Watching Futmetrix Score: 60/100. A massive relegation clash where three points mean the difference between hope and absolute despair at the bottom of Liga 1.
The Setup
Gelora Bumi Kartini Stadium sets the stage for a tense relegation battle on April 24, 2026. Persijap enter the fray in 14th place with 21 points, just three points ahead of their desperate visitors. PSBS Biak Numfor are rooted to the bottom in 18th place, desperately clinging to survival. The Stakes are massive in this classic six-pointer, where a defeat could severely damage either side's hopes of staying in the top flight.
Neither team brings much to the table in terms of dazzling football. PSBS arrive with a miserable Form rating, having lost four of their last five outings while shipping goals at an alarming rate. Persijap are hardly flying themselves, stringing together a series of nervous draws. With very little presence of Stars on either roster, this match is stripped back to raw effort. Both sides struggle with Balance, leading to disjointed attacks and panicked defending, ensuring a gritty, chaotic war of attrition rather than a tactical masterclass.
Key Battle
Without standout marquee players, this game will be decided by which unit blinks first. Persijap's shaky defensive line must weather the desperate, direct attacks of PSBS Biak Numfor. Given that the visitors have already conceded 53 times this season, the home attackers must simply avoid overcomplicating things and punish the inevitable lapses in the away side's chaotic rearguard.
Our Prediction
We expect a scrappy 2-1 victory for Persijap. Home advantage and the sheer defensive incompetence of the visitors should allow Persijap to edge a nervous encounter, piling further misery on PSBS Biak Numfor.
